Three students were injured today in a knife at a school in Pirkala, southwestern Finland, and the suspect, a student of the educational institution, was arrested, police said today.

Police were alerted to the attack at 10:42 local time (and time in Greece) and have rushed first aid workshops

Police are investigating media information that the 16 -year -old student allegedly targeted girls during the attack, a police spokesman added.

The suspect allegedly sent a “manifesto” to the Finnish media this morning. It is said to have stated that he was planning to stab girls and then surrender to the police.

He also allegedly wrote that he was planning the attack for six months, according to local media.

The educational institution has a primary school and a Gymnasium, police said on its website.

The three injured do not bear injuries that put their lives at risk, police spokesman Nina Yurakou told AFP.
